A theorem in geometry states that the measure of an inscribed angle.

SAT
1 answer:
gizmo_the_mogwai [7]3 years ago
5 0

Answer:

A theorem in geometry states that the measure of an inscribed angle is half the measure of its intercepted arc.

How many grams of lead product would theoretically be produced between 17. 0 g potassium iodide, ki, and 25. 0 g of lead (ii) ni
Fantom [35]

The number of grams of lead product that would theoretically be produced from the given reaction is; <u><em>Mass of lead product = 23.6 g</em></u>

Potassium iodide reacting with Lead(II) Nitrate would yield the balanced equation;

2KI + Pb(NO₃)₂ = 2KNO₃ + PbI₂

2moles : 1 mole = 2 moles : 1 mole

From online tables;

Molar mass of KI = 166 g/mol

Molar mass of Pb(NO₃)₂ = 331.2 g/mol

We are given;

Mass of KI = 17 g

Mass of Pb(NO₃)₂ = 25 g

Thus;

Number of moles of PbI₂ yielded in order to find the limiting reactant will be;

no of moles of PbI₂ from KI = (17g/166 g/mol) × (1 mole of PbI₂/2 mol of KI)

no of moles of PbI₂ from KI = 0.0512 mols

Similarly;

no of moles of PbI₂ from Pb(NO₃)₂ = (25g/331.2 g/mol) × (1 mole of PbI₂/1 mol of Pb(NO₃)₂)

no of moles of PbI₂ from Pb(NO₃)₂ = 0.0755 moles

We can see that KI produced the least amount of moles. Thus;

Mass = 0.0512 * molar mass of  PbI₂

From tables, molar mass of  PbI₂ = 461 g/mol

Thus;

Mass of lead product = 461 * 0.0512

Mass of lead product = 23.6 g

The list is not found here but planets are ordered from closest to farthest to the Sun as Mercury, Venus, Earth, Mars, Jupiter, Saturn, Uranus, and Neptune.

<h3>What are the closest planets to the Sun?</h3>

The closest planets to the Sun are rocky planets, i.e., Mercury, Venus, Earth and Mars.

Conversely, the farthest planets to the Sun are gaseous planets, i.e., Jupiter, Saturn, Uranus, and Neptune.

In conclusion, the list is not found here but planets are ordered from closest to farthest to the Sun as Mercury, Venus, Earth, Mars, Jupiter, Saturn, Uranus, and Neptune.
